Course Details
• Email Infrastructure Fundamentals: Understanding the basics of email infrastructure, including SMTP, POP, and IMAP protocols, and email flow.
• Email Security Best Practices: Implementing and maintaining security best practices, such as SPF, DKIM, and DMARC, to prevent email spoofing and phishing.
• Email Encryption Techniques: Utilizing encryption methods, like TLS and S/MIME, to secure email communication.
• Email Archiving and Backup Strategies: Developing and implementing effective email archiving and backup plans to ensure data durability and regulatory compliance.
• Email Server Hardening: Securing email servers by configuring firewalls, updating software, and applying security patches.
• Managing Email Access and Authentication: Implementing secure email access and authentication methods, such as multi-factor authentication and OAuth, to protect sensitive information.
• Email Policy and Compliance Management: Creating and enforcing email policies and procedures to meet regulatory requirements and industry best practices.
• Monitoring and Incident Response: Setting up monitoring systems to detect and respond to email security incidents, including intrusion detection and log analysis.
• Email Threat Intelligence and Analysis: Leveraging threat intelligence feeds and analysis tools to detect and respond to emerging email threats, such as malware and ransomware.
